CAS Number: 141-43-5

INCI: Monoethanolamine

Composition: FINECHEMO-MEA is composed of a single molecule, Monoethanolamine (MEA), which consists of an ethanolamine derivative containing one amine group and one hydroxyl group. It is commonly used as a pH balancer, emulsifier, and surfactant in personal care and industrial formulations.

Purity Grade: Technical Grade (typically ≥ 99%)

Appearance: Clear, colorless to pale yellow liquid

Solubility: Soluble in water and alcohol; miscible with most organic solvents

Preservation: Does not require additional preservatives, as it is stable under normal conditions. However, formulations containing Monoethanolamine should be properly pH-balanced to avoid instability.

Storage: Store in a tightly sealed container in a cool, dry place. Keep away from moisture and direct sunlight. Use in a well-ventilated area.

Raw Material Sources: Synthetic – typically derived from the reaction of ethylene oxide with ammonia.

Manufacture: Produced by the reaction of ethylene oxide with ammonia to form ethanolamine, followed by distillation and purification to obtain Monoethanolamine.

Animal Testing: Not animal tested

GMO: GMO-free (synthetic production, not derived from genetically modified organisms)

Vegan: Does not contain animal-derived ingredients

Proposition: FINECHEMO-MEA complies with relevant safety regulations, including those of the EU Cosmetics Regulation and U.S. FDA guidelines, for use in personal care products, household products, and industrial applications.

Warning: Handle with care. Monoethanolamine is corrosive and may cause irritation to the skin, eyes, and respiratory tract. Use appropriate protective equipment such as gloves and safety goggles during handling. In case of contact with eyes or skin, rinse immediately with plenty of water.

Powerful Alkaline Agent — Use with Precision & Controlled Handling

• Typical use level:
0.1–5% in cosmetics
2–15% in detergents & industrial cleaners
• Always add slowly to avoid overheating
• Strong base → handle with PPE (gloves, goggles)
• Avoid skin & eye contact; corrosive in concentrated form
• Store in tightly sealed containers away from heat & moisture
• Compatible with most surfactants, fatty acids & emulsifiers
• Not recommended for leave-on skincare

pH Regulation: Helps maintain optimal pH in formulations, enhancing product safety and performance.
Emulsification Support: Aids in blending oil and water phases, improving formulation consistency.
Cleansing Efficiency: Enhances the foaming and cleansing properties of surfactant systems.
Versatile Use: Compatible with a wide range of ingredients, especially in hair colorants and cream formulations.

Hair Dyes and Relaxers: Used to adjust pH and activate colorants or chemical processes.
Facial Cleansers and Body Washes: Improves foam quality and cleansing action.
Creams and Lotions: Helps stabilize emulsions and supports product integrity.
Shaving Products: Used to maintain pH and support foam performance.

When used within regulated concentrations and properly neutralized, FINECHEMO-MEA is considered safe for topical application in cosmetic formulations. Its use is subject to regulatory limits, and formulations should follow industry safety guidelines.

FINECHEMO-MEA can be irritating in high concentrations or if improperly formulated. It is essential that it is used within acceptable limits and combined with skin-conditioning agents. Patch testing of final formulations is strongly recommended for sensitive users.
